Anyone recognize this part? I was working to replace the motor in my door lock actuators and this just happened to fall out when i was removing the door lock actuator assembly - or it fell out at some point during the process. Not quite sure where it came from. It's a soft plastic that is squishy. I didn't show the end of the long barrel, but it is hollow as well. Hoping to put the door back together tonight and was hoping someone might recognize it so I could properly reinstall! Thanks in advance!

Is that the water drain tube attached to some part of the actuator?
 
I had that fall off too when I was replacing my lock actuator motors. I had to wait until I removed another one to figure out how it went on. It fits on the black plastic body of the actuator, not sure if as a drain or what. It plugs onto the nipple that is between the cover and the plug here. You can make it out in the second picture to the right of the white tube.
